The words of Ventotene

The words of Ventotene (2019)

June 22nd, 20190h 54min

Documentary, History
0%

Overview

The film focuses on Ernesto Rossi (1897 – 1967), who was imprisoned by the fascist regime between 1930 and 1943 for his political ideas. Exiled on the island of Ventotene, he co-authored the Ventotene manifesto.
